Everyday Fauna Concerns and Humane Approaches

As cities grow, various wildlife species often venture into residential areas, leading to common problems such as property damage, safety concerns, and disturbances. Raccoons, for instance, can infiltrate attics, creating structural damage and noise. Squirrels may gnaw on wires, posing fire hazards. Additionally, deer can destroy gardens and landscaping, while birds may nest in unwanted areas, raising the risk of droppings that carry diseases.

Solutions for addressing these concerns emphasize prevention and exclusion. Installing reinforced trash bins and using raccoon-resistant bird feeders can discourage scavengers. For squirrels, closing off entry points and providing alternative nesting sites can reduce invasions. Landscaping changes, such as cultivating deer-resistant plants, can help protect gardens. These strategies not only address wildlife conflicts but also advance peaceful coexistence, ensuring both property safety and the well-being of local wildlife.

How Specialists Analyze Wildlife Challenges

Specialists examine wildlife issues through a methodical approach that incorporates observation, evidence collection, and analysis. Initially, they carry out a thorough survey of the property, searching for signs of wildlife presence such as droppings, tracks, or nesting materials. This physical evidence helps determine the species involved and the extent of the problem.

Next, specialists assess possible access areas and habitats that might attract wildlife, taking into account factors like food sources and shelter. They also examine the property's environment, including landscaping and building components, to identify any changes that can reduce upcoming problems.

Additionally, professionals may gather information from homeowners about observations or incidents, providing valuable insight for their evaluation. By integrating these different components, wildlife removal specialists can create a detailed understanding of the situation, ensuring that future steps are well-founded and successful in tackling the wildlife concerns.

Instructions on Blocking Wildlife Intrusions

Preventing wildlife encroachments calls for preventive actions that construct an area less tempting to fauna. Homeowners should begin by securing trash bins with snug-fitting lids and keeping food supplies, such as pet food and birdseed, indoors or in closed containers. Additionally, gardens should be fenced or protected with netting to ward off scavenging wildlife.

It is vital to close possible openings, such as gaps in roofs, walls, and foundations, using products like steel mesh or sealant. Regularly inspecting and maintaining buildings can help detect weak points before they turn into issues.

Landscaping options also have a important part; opting for native plants can lessen the draw to certain wildlife. Finally, clearing away standing water and debris destroys habitats that attract animals. By implementing these approaches, property owners can greatly decrease the chance of unwelcome wildlife encounters.

What Is the Price of Expert Wildlife Elimination Services?

Professional wildlife control services commonly run between $150 to $500, fluctuating with factors like the animal type, the extent of invasion, and the techniques and strategies implemented.
